The Asthma Score in 69333, Ashby, Nebraska is 42 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

79.31 percent of the population in 69333 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 65.52 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 12.07 percent of the residents in 69333 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.76 members with about 1.93 cars available per household.

An estimate of 85.58 percent of the residents in 69333 has some form of health insurance. 43.27 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 66.35 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 69333 would have to travel an average of 47.74 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Box Butte General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 69333, Ashby, Nebraska.

As of , an estimate of 208 residents live in 69333 with a median age of 38.7 years. 19.71 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 13.46 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 41.04 percent of the residents in 69333 is currently married, and 22.54 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 69333 is $5,434.00.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 69333 is approximately $660. The median household spends about 12.15 percent of their income on housing.
